Parma host Cagliari on Friday in a game that might look ordinary at first glance, yet it carries weight. You glance at the table and see 12th against 13th. Just three points separate the Crusaders and the Islanders. That sounds close. However, recent form suggests the gap in confidence and rhythm may be slightly wider than it appears.

Since 2020, Parma and Cagliari have met ten times across Serie A and Serie B. Cagliari hold the edge with five wins, including the last three, though only three clean sheets in that spell. Parma have won once, four ended level. Goals have not been scarce either, averaging 3.1 per game.

Parma team overview

After beating Bologna and Verona, few expected Parma to walk into San Siro and leave with a 1-0 win over Milan. Yet the Crusaders did exactly that. Three straight victories, something not achieved since their Serie B run in 2024, have pushed them 15 points clear of danger. That cushion changes the mood around Ennio Tardini.

Carlos Cuesta’s side have also avoided defeat in three of their last five at home. Confidence is visible. There were no fresh injuries against Milan, so continuity seems likely. Mariano Troilo opened his account for the season in that win and should keep his place at the back. Top scorer Mateo Pellegrino continues to lead the line.

Matija Frigan remains sidelined with a cruciate ligament injury. Zion Suzuki is out with a hand problem, Abdoulaye Ndiaye has a pubic issue, and Pontus Almqvist is nursing a hamstring strain.

Cagliari team overview

Cagliari stopped a two match losing run with a goalless draw against Lazio. Solid, yes, but not entirely convincing. The Islanders have now failed to score in three straight league matches.

That lack of cutting edge will worry Fabio Pisacane, especially away from home where two of the last three have ended in defeat.

Cagliari travel without Yerry Mina after his late red card last weekend, which forces a reshuffle at the back. Riyad Idrissi may come in next to Zé Pedro and Alberto Dossena.

Andrea Belotti is still recovering from a long term cruciate injury. Mattia Felici faces the same setback, while Alessandro Deiola and Gianluca Gaetano remain out.

Prediction

Parma feel different lately. Winning three in a row, and doing it with a disciplined 1-0 at San Siro, tends to shift belief inside a dressing room. The Crusaders now sit comfortably 15 points above the bottom three. Cagliari are stalling a bit, three games without scoring. Add eight straight away matches without a clean sheet and 2-1 at Ennio Tardini seems fair.

Three reasons we expect at least three goals in this game

  1. Four of the last six meetings between Parma and Cagliari produced over 2.5 goals.
  2. Cagliari are without a clean sheet in their last eight away games.
  3. The last two home games of Parma produced eight goals in total.
